The YMCA of Greater Richmond is looking for a positive role model to help plan programming, assist with center oversight, and supervise children in our program at Saint Joseph Catholic School. The starting pay is $17 per hour or based on experience. The YMCA of Greater Richmond is a nonprofit with the goal of strengthening the foundations of community. We do this by providing programs that help build a healthy mind, body and spirit for all, and our programs focus on our three focus areas: Healthy Living, Youth Development and Social Responsibility.
